The History of American Quarter Horses in South Africa

The history of American Quarter Horses in South Africa dates back several decades. Originating in the United States, these horses were bred for their speed and agility, making them ideal for quarter-mile races. Through various international exchanges and importations, American Quarter Horses found their way to South Africa, captivating equestrians with their exceptional abilities and gentle disposition.

In time, South African breeders recognized the potential of these magnificent creatures and began breeding Quarter Horses locally. Their popularity rapidly grew as their versatility and adaptability became apparent. American Quarter Horses found success not only in racing but also in other equestrian disciplines such as reining, cutting, and western pleasure.

The Process of Adopting an American Quarter Horse in Upington

The process of adopting an American Quarter Horse in Upington is designed to ensure that both the horse and the adopter find a suitable match. Prospective adopters are required to follow a series of steps to demonstrate their commitment to providing a safe and loving environment for the horse.

Initially, interested individuals must contact the adoption program and express their desire to adopt a Quarter Horse. An application form is then provided, requiring detailed information about the prospective adopter’s previous experience with horses, stable facilities, available resources, and their plans for the horse’s future.

After reviewing the applications, adoption program representatives conduct interviews with the potential adopters to gain a deeper understanding of their motivations and their ability to care for an American Quarter Horse. This step allows for mutual expectations to be clarified, which is crucial for a successful adoption.

Upon approval, the adopters must undergo a comprehensive facility inspection to ensure that the horse will be housed in a safe and suitable environment. Stable conditions, fencing, turnout areas, and access to fresh water and adequate food supply are all factors thoroughly assessed during this process.

Finally, once these steps are successfully completed, the adopter is matched with an appropriate horse and provided with guidance and support during the transition period to ensure a smooth integration into their new home.

Challenges and Considerations for Adopting an American Quarter Horse in Upington

While American Quarter Horse adoption in Upington offers numerous benefits, it is important to be aware of the challenges and considerations that come with welcoming an adopted horse into a new home.

Firstly, adopted horses may require additional time and effort to establish trust and overcome any past traumas they may have experienced. Patience and understanding are essential during the initial stages of their integration into a new environment.

Moreover, adopting a retired or unwanted horse may mean dealing with potential health issues or age-related conditions. Adopters should be prepared to provide the necessary veterinary care and be understanding of any limitations the horse may have due to their age or previous experiences.

Financial considerations are also an important aspect to bear in mind. The cost of horse ownership, including feed, regular vet visits, farrier services, and other general expenses, must be factored into the adopter’s budget to ensure the horse’s ongoing well-being.

Lastly, adopting a horse is a long-term commitment, and potential adopters should carefully consider their lifestyle, available time, and resources. Horses require daily care, exercise, and attention, so it is crucial to have the time and dedication to provide these essential aspects of horse ownership.
